Notes
This, the largest man-made small-boat harbor in the world, was dredged from the wetlands fed by Ballona Creek. Harbor provides all of the expected facilities and some first class hotels and a variety of restaurants. GPS point taken at tip of Burton Chace Park, where there are also day-use slips and 34 slips for overnighters on a first come first-serve basis (limit 7 days in 30).
